Task description

The Manager will contribute to all phases of the M&A deal cycle, including project origination, structuring, execution, implementation and monitoring.

The role is multifaceted with key tasks:

  • Financial modeling and analysis,
  • Knowledge about the PV permitting process,
  • Information gathering and drafting of Teasers, Information Memorandums,
  • Collection of documents related to projects being sold (feed to sell-side data rooms),
  • Analysis of due-diligence info packs (in the buy-side deals) including project and market information to analyse and quantify potential risks related to the proposed project,
  • Identification of potential investors for RE-projects disposals,
  • Identification of potential acquisition targets / business development projects,
  • Support in the selection of advisors, primarily M&A-teams and lawyers,
  • Support in negotiations of transaction agreements.
